Synopsis

The Definitive Telecommunications Reference--Fully Updated

Understand cutting-edge telecommunication and networking technologies using this straightforward, real-world implementation guide.  Fully revised to cover all of the latest transmission protocols, Voice & Data Communications Handbook, Fifth Edition covers all the bases-from analog transmission, VPNs, and LANs to DSL, CATV, WiFi, VoIP, and GSM. This authoritative volume covers the ins-and-outs of each vital topic, supplies practical examples and solutions, and provides helpful self-tests.  You'll also find up-to-date information on regulatory standards, switches, routers, frame relay, and security procedures.

About the Author

Regis J."Bud" Bates, president of TC International Consulting, has 40 years of experience in telecommunications and information systems. He is a wireless systems expert who specializes in network operations and planning and is the author of more than 15 technology-oriented books.

Donald W. Gregory is a partner with Computer Sciences Corporation's Consulting Group (CSC). Previously, he worked at Arthur Andersen, International Harvester/Navistar, and Digital Equipment Corp. specializing in the design and implementation of data and voice communications networks.
